Glebe Centre is a non-profit long-term care home in Ottawa, licensed for 254 beds. It is accredited. Below you can find its full Ministry of Long-Term Care inspection record, Health Quality Ontario care indicators, and how it compares with the Ontario average.

Waiting list751 people on the list

Calculated by the Ministry of Long-Term Care, as of April 30, 2026.

Resident-care measures for the 2023/24 fiscal year (a single year, not a multi-year average), compared with the Ontario average.

Quick read

In the most recent findings, 3 of 6 care measures are higher than the Ontario average: Pressure ulcers, Pain, and Worsened depression. Falls are lower than the Ontario average, while Physical restraints and Antipsychotic use are similar. For these measures, a lower percentage means fewer residents were affected.

  • Air TemperatureEnvironment & safety

    Inspectors found that the home did not document air temperatures at the required times (morning, afternoon between 12 p.m. and 5 p.m., and evening/night) for resident bedrooms, designated cooling areas, and common areas. Records from May–June 2026 showed multiple instances where these temperature readings were not recorded.
